WebMar 1, 2024 · In M1 macrophages or under hypoxia, glucose is incompletely oxidized to produce the metabolite lactate. Lactate is then able to generate lactyl-CoA, which contributes a lactyl group to the lysine tails of histone proteins via the acetyltransferase enzyme p300 to produce a modification called lactyllysine.
